WebReview of Irish Studies in Europe (RISE) is an international, open-access, peer-reviewed, multidisciplinary journal that publishes articles and reviews within the field of Irish Studies. We are dedicated to the publication of new and innovative research within and between the broad range of disciplines and areas engaged with Irish Studies. WebOct 8, 2024 · James H. Murphy is Professor of English and Director of Irish Studies at Boston College. He is the author or editor of fourteen books, which include Catholic Fiction and Social Reality in Ireland, 1873–1922 (Greenwood Press, 1997), Irish Novelists and the Victorian Age (Oxford University Press, 2011), and The Oxford History of the Irish Book, …
